Lilium
/ˈlɪli.əm/noun
A genus of flowering plants known as lilies.
Did you know?Latin lilium is the source of the scientific genus name for lilies, and its deeper pre-Latin origin is uncertain, which is exactly why this flower’s name has long felt ancient and almost enchanted.
